Ada, Oklahoma is a small town located in Pontotoc County in the southeastern part of the state. It is home to several religious congregations, each offering its unique style of worship and faith-based activities. The congregations include churches from various denominations such as Baptist, Methodist, Presbyterian, and nondenominational. They provide religious education for children and adults alike, as well as a variety of Bible Study classes and Sunday school opportunities at all levels. Additionally, many churches have local outreach programs that are designed to help meet the needs of their community. These churches offer a place for spiritual growth and fellowship to those who live in Ada. By hosting community events such as Christmas caroling and other seasonal activities, these churches are active members of their community, providing comfort and guidance to all who seek it.

59.1% of the people in Ada are religious:
- 32.9% are Baptist
- 0.5% are Episcopalian
- 1.6% are Catholic
- 0.3% are Lutheran
- 6.4% are Methodist
- 4.0% are Pentecostal
- 0.9% are Presbyterian
- 1.4% are Church of Jesus Christ
- 10.1% are another Christian faith
- 0.1% are Judaism
- 0.0% are an eastern faith
- 0.8% affilitates with Islam
